News summary

Rory McIlroy, the 2025 Masters champion, is gearing up for the Ryder Cup at Bethpage Black with a strong belief in Team Europe's ability to win on American soil, despite anticipating a hostile and partisan U.S. crowd. McIlroy has openly predicted an 'inevitable' clash between the teams due to the intense atmosphere and has recalled past heated encounters, including a notable spat with Patrick Cantlay's caddie during the 2023 Ryder Cup. His confidence is bolstered by the current strong form of European players and the continuity in team leadership under captain Luke Donald, making him more optimistic than in previous away Ryder Cups. McIlroy draws inspiration from Michael Jordan's resilience and is motivated to create memorable moments by making crucial putts, viewing this phase as the final third of his career where he thrives under pressure. Former Ryder Cup captain Paul McGinley highlighted McIlroy's mental engagement and ability to peak during big events, noting his recent Irish Open win as a sign of readiness. Overall, McIlroy emphasizes the importance of team unity and managing the challenging environment while aiming to defend Europe's title against the formidable U.S. team.
